Leaked tape: Security operative reveals he used girls to get secrets from Bugri Naabu

Leaked tape: Security operative reveals he used girls to get secrets from Bugri Naabu
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

As more tapes get leaked following the infamous leaked tape about an alleged plot to remove the Inspector General of Police (IGP), Dr George Akuffo Dampare, more intriguing details are holding Ghanaians spellbound.

There are fascinating details caught in both audio and video where embattled former Northern Regional Chairman of the New Patriotic Party(NPP) Bugri Naabuis heard or seen negotiating bribe amounts or making shocking revelations about his relationship with the police service or the IGP.

In one of the latest leaked tapes, a security operative known as Boyoo, who sought to expose Bugri Naabu for failing to tell the truth to him about payments he receives from the IGP, set a bevy of slay queens on him to help him extract the much-guarded information.

The unidentified male security operative, who is well-known to Chief Bugri Naabu, revealed that after Chief Bugri Naabu refused to admit to being paid by the IGP, he conducted an investigation to get him to admit to receiving the payments.

“But Chairman, let me tell you today, the reason why I set ladies on you: It’s the day we came and asked you about the CV. You said that you’re not getting anything from Dampare. And we make an investigation. Dampare is paying you… He’s paying you GHC 10, 000,” the operative said in a recorded phone call with Chief Bugri Naabu.

Chief Bugri Naabu admitted to receiving the payment but explained that it was paid to him by the police service for the security work he does as a paramount chief.

There appears to be an avalanche of tapes that will be leaked in the coming days as Parliament probes the first leaked tape and following the interdiction of the three police officers heard in that tape
